he pictures show a grassy field that has been abandoned. Which best explains why this is an example of increasing entropy?
a)Energy is conserved as the lawn changes.
b)The lawn is a system that uses energy.
c)Work was done to change the lawn over time.
d)Over time, the lawn has naturally become disorderly.

Respuesta :

Answer:

The correct answer is option D. Which is "Over time, the lawn has naturally become disorderly".

Explanation:

  • Entropy, the measure of a system's thermal energy per unit temperature that is unavailable for doing useful work.
  • It is also a measure of the molecular disorder, or randomness, of a system.
  • According to above definitions of entropy option D is correct.
  • So entropy of system is randomness/disorder that is increasing with time in case of lawn.
